Pfarrkirche Inzersdorf ob der Traisen

Pfarrkirche Inzersdorf ob der Traisen, Parish church in Inzersdorf-Getzersdorf, Austria.

Pfarrkirche Inzersdorf ob der Traisen is a parish church featuring a five-story north tower with plastered corners and barrel-vaulted windows set beneath a gabled roof. The building displays typical rural church architecture from earlier centuries with these characteristic structural elements.

The building originated as the church of Unter-Inzersdorf parish around 1140 and was later placed under the monastery of Klein-Mariazell. In 1784 the church came under the administration of Herzogenburg Abbey.

The interior displays religious artwork and statues from the 18th century, including representations of saints in the side sections. These artistic elements shape how visitors experience the sacred space and reflect the devotional practices of that era.

The church preserves a bell cast in 1517 that has survived several centuries, making it one of the oldest objects in the building. The baroque pulpit is decorated with the coat of arms of Klein-Mariazell monastery, showing the historical connection between the church and the cloister.
